    Im thinking about going from nitrous to turbos on my car. The engine makes 640 at the flywheel N/A @ 10.25:1 compression. I plan on going with a blow through alcohol carburetor and keeping the compression where its at but will change the cam to a turbo friendly grind after seeing how my nitrous solid roller plays with the turbo.

    Im looking at the MP GT45 with 1.0 A/R turbine housing X2
